Mass numbers of typical isotopes of Boron are 10; 11. Atomic mass of Boron is 10.811 u. The atomic mass is the mass of an atom. The atomic mass or relative isotopic mass refers to the mass of a single particle, and therefore is tied to a certain specific isotope of an element.
What is the molar mass of boron?What is molar mass of Boron? Boron has symbol B . The molar mass if same as the atomic mass and the atomic mass of boron is 10.81 amu so its molar mass is 10.81 g/mol.
